So, how do you get in on this? It’s refreshingly straightforward. You can usually sign up right on the Olive Garden website. Look for a section dedicated to their loyalty program, often called 'Olive Garden Rewards' or something similar. It typically involves creating an account, which might just need your email address and a password. Sometimes, they’ll ask for a bit more information, like your birthday, which can unlock special treats later on.

Once you're signed up, the magic starts to happen. Every time you dine at Olive Garden and use your rewards account (usually by providing your phone number or scanning a QR code from their app), you’ll earn points. These points are like little tokens of appreciation that add up. And what do they add up to? Free food, of course! You can often redeem your points for appetizers, desserts, or even full entrees. And here’s a little insider tip I picked up: these rewards can often be combined with other Darden gift cards. So, if you’ve received a Darden gift card (which works at Olive Garden and LongHorn Steakhouse, among others), you can still earn rewards on your purchase. It’s a double win! You get to use your gift card, and you’re still racking up points for future visits. It really maximizes the value of every dollar spent.
